How much notice do you need for a booking in NW1?
A few days is comfortable for most NW1 sites, and we can often cover urgent work at shorter notice. Jobs needing NATS or ATC coordination, or access to a restricted site, need longer, and we will flag that as soon as we see the brief.
How long will you be on site in NW1?
Most single-subject jobs take one to three hours on site including setup, briefing and packing down. Larger sites, multiple elevations or survey work take longer, and we confirm the expected window when we quote.
